Unix系统作为一种开源操作系统,自从1969年由贝尔实验室开发以来,便以其开放、自由、共享的代码理念,引领着全球计算机操作系统的发展。本文将探讨Unix开放代码的传奇,分析其背后的理念、影响及未来发展趋势。
一、Unix开放代码的理念
1. 自由与共享:Unix开放代码的核心是自由与共享。它鼓励用户在遵守相关协议的前提下,自由地使用、修改和分发Unix代码。这种理念源于Unix创始人肯·汤普森和丹尼斯·里奇所倡导的“共享精神”。

2. 开放性:Unix开放代码具有极高的开放性。用户可以方便地获取Unix源代码,对其进行研究和改进。这种开放性使得Unix在计算机科学领域具有广泛的吸引力。
3. 模块化:Unix系统采用模块化设计,将系统功能划分为独立的模块。这种设计使得Unix代码易于扩展和维护,同时也方便用户根据自己的需求进行定制。
二、Unix开放代码的影响
1. 推动计算机科学的发展:Unix开放代码为全球计算机科学家提供了一个研究、交流和共享的平台。许多重要的计算机科学研究成果都是在Unix环境下诞生的。
2. 促进操作系统技术的创新:Unix开放代码使得操作系统技术得到了广泛的应用和创新。许多知名操作系统,如Linux、Mac OS等,都是在Unix的基础上发展起来的。
3. 降低软件成本:Unix开放代码使得用户可以免费获取操作系统和应用程序,从而降低了软件成本,提高了软件的普及率。
三、Unix开放代码的未来发展趋势
1. 跨平台发展:随着云计算、大数据等技术的兴起,Unix开放代码将向更多平台和领域拓展,如移动设备、物联网等。
2. 深度整合:Unix开放代码将与其他开源项目进行深度整合,形成更加完善的生态系统。
3. 智能化:随着人工智能技术的不断发展,Unix开放代码将朝着智能化方向发展,为用户提供更加便捷、高效的计算环境。
Unix开放代码以其自由、共享的理念,为全球计算机操作系统的发展做出了巨大贡献。在未来的发展中,Unix开放代码将继续引领开源技术潮流,为人类创造更加美好的数字生活。
参考文献:
[1]汤普森,肯. Unix操作系统[M]. 机械工业出版社,2011.
[2]里奇,丹尼斯. C程序设计语言[M]. 人民邮电出版社,2008.
[3]Linux内核权威指南[M]. 电子工业出版社,2014.